In this MR technologist role, there would be a focus on MR safety.

You will work with other technologist team members in providing superior patient care; comfort, safety and confidentiality.

Specific job details:

  • Operation of MRI Scanners: responsible for patient safety, the performance of high quality Scans, performing and remaining current on MRI protocols

  • Communicate and work with other staff, emergency department and nursing floors in the care for our patients.

  • Play an active role in the vetting of implants while working with MRSO and MRMD to assure patient safety.

  • Work as part of the team to ensure that the department is kept ready for Joint Commission review and ACR standards.

  • Ordering supplies, inventory, cleaning equipment, and scan room preparation.

  • Troubleshooting equipment issues and reporting them to the relevant department when necessary

  • Utilize ancillary tools and equipment appropriately: PACS and other software systems

  • Image Post Processing: responsible for post processing images including transfer of images to PACS, ensuring all post processing steps are complete

POSITION SUMMARY

This position performs prescribed procedures in accordance with department/facility policies, procedures and protocols. This position ensures optimal care/treatment to patient population.

CORE FUNCTIONS

  1. Performs procedures by following and verifying referring providers’ orders. Uses independent judgment and applies learned methodologies according to established policy and procedures.

  2. Educates patients/families regarding procedure and/or treatment to be performed. Demonstrates professional behavior/conduct in all interactions; fosters teamwork, efficient use of resources and quality patient outcomes.

  3. Produces high quality images and prepares/presents them with other pertinent patient information for timely interpretation. Prepares and maintains accurate documentation.

  4. Demonstrates competence in performing prescribed invasive/interventional procedures if applicable in accordance with established policies if applicable.

  5. Performs and evaluates equipment quality control measurements. Demonstrates the ability to trouble shoot and notifies appropriate personnel to maintain equipment performance. Maintains a safe environment for patients, personnel, and visitors. Adheres to safety policies.

  6. Accountable for the ethical, legal, and professional responsibilities related to the radiology practice. This includes maintaining confidentiality of all work information.

  7. Assures the efficient operation of workflow of the department. Monitors and maintains an adequate inventory of supplies and material to ensure non-interruption of services.

  8. Independently performs prescribed procedures in accordance with department/facility policies, procedures and protocols to patients. Internal customers: All levels of medical imaging and nursing management and staff, medical staff, and all other members of the interdisciplinary health care team. External Customers: regulatory and health agencies, patients and family members.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Requires national certification from the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) and/or modality qualified licensure (NMTCB, ARDMS, ARMRIT). Licensure by the state regulatory agency, as applicable. Advance certification by accrediting body in MRI required within 18 months of hire. BLS certification required.
